With new mobile devices and operating systems becoming popular and necessary for businesses to develop applications that showcase goods and services, creating mobile business apps has never been more prevalent; they showcase goods and services more easily while growing companies have to consider developing mobile business apps as part of their growth strategies.
While creating business apps may become simpler over time, if your goal is growth, then investing in proper marketing campaign methods, methods as well as money, will need to expand.
Development of a mobile application by businesses involves more than technological progress; you also require business knowledge and skills for effective user-friendliness of an app.
We will discuss some essential points every business owner, app developer, or service-providing company should bear in mind before embarking on such an undertaking.
Top Key Factors When Developing Mobile Applications
Investigation
Once youve had a fantastic idea for an impressive mobile application for your company, the first thing that must be understood is market conditions: consumer trends and demands.
Conduct market research before adding any technological components; you might gain invaluable information through market studies reports about how people accept similar apps on the market and know about rivals tactics against you - this way your app can be optimized from its inception. Developers.dev holds that "Learning from others mistakes rather than your own is essential."
Reviews from previous customers can provide valuable insight into their preferences, choices and needs - as well as any pain areas that need fixing in your mobile app.
Research allows for enhanced planning capabilities to build robust apps from day one.
Determine Your Target Market
Researching is crucial and should include finding your target consumers for your app since their role is vital to its development and further expansion and evolution of features and thus ultimately determines its fate.
When creating an application, we must consider who might use it and how they might benefit from it. Otherwise, your app wont become popular and help boost revenues as a user interface.
Selecting An Appropriate Platform
One of the critical aspects to keep in mind when planning for deployment is your choice of platform. Its recommended to begin on just one platform, becoming proficient on it first before expanding later onto others like iOS, Android and Windows apps platforms.
When choosing an appropriate platform for your mobile application, several key aspects must be considered, including its features, target market, brand image and--most importantly--price plan.
It would help if you then decide whether your app should use hybrid, native, or mobile web development. However, native apps provide many benefits but could become quite pricey over time.
Want More Information About Our Services? Talk to Our Consultants!
Outline An Action Plan
Before creating your business mobile platforms, fully comprehend its development process. Building a high-performing app development process takes some effort, time and dedication, as well as going through several phases.
Before moving forward with their venture, mobile application development business owners should understand the significance of each stage in developing an app: complex project management, application architecture, design, testing, enhancement, enhancement and deployment - these are essential for app success. Firstly, create a plan of action for app development stages; monitoring and control are paramount. Release a beta version first, then conduct rigorous reviews before unveiling its full release for end-user use.
Understand Your Budget
Mobile app development company requires money, expertise and planning - three essential ingredients of success.
Budget allocation should be allocated judiciously throughout the rapid application development process: mobile app development costs must cover development cycles, maintenance, updates, and promotion costs, which are separate issues altogether - they all contribute toward creating your app. Your app budget depends heavily upon its specialization: your specialty defines what types of materials and applications to include within its development scope.
Think Out Of The Box
People are constantly searching for something different and unique; that is why so many consumers prefer one brand over its similar competitors: because they believe this one offers something extra special.
A great way of tapping this desire for novelty is using mobile applications - humans quickly become bored of one thing. At the same time, millions of smartphone apps exist, meaning app users want something exciting or different each time.
Therefore, thinking creatively when developing strategies or features is recommended so your users dont abandon you for another alternative service provider.
Seamlessly Operable
Your company mobile app development team must function seamlessly. Slow loading times or poor user experiences could prove devastating, leaving customers either disgruntled with its performance, uninstalling, or only occasionally revisiting it on future visits - creating a poor first impression with user engagement.
Ensure your program consumes only a little memory or processing power of mobile devices to ensure maximum efficacy for success.
Users demand efficiency from any mobile application they download; this covers security, battery use, data efficiency, and user-friendliness.
Your app could quickly stop working for you if it consumes an excessive amount of 3G/4G bandwidth; users could download but never come back; therefore, develop it so it does not consume too much of users data and drain the battery quickly.
Read More: Maximizing Business Success with Mobile App Development
User Experience And Evaluation Methodology
User experience is at the core of an apps success; otherwise, users will need more reason to return and utilize your software.
User experience has become an ever more crucial aspect of digital life - your app shapes users perception of your brand and offerings while shaping their understanding of them, too. Success lies in crafting useful, user-friendly apps designed for specific markets - no one wants an inconvenient or difficult app.
Careful mobile app design that ensures an excellent user experience can bring many tangible advantages. Your target user base must be accommodated functionally and content-wise within your app; its finished result should provide superior customer service; otherwise, it risks damaging your brand image.
Stay Focused On Your Marketing Plan
Building an app for your company is only worthwhile by thinking carefully about how you will promote and market it to potential customers.
Building excitement before its release can help your app gain immediate popularity among its target market; unfortunately, most entrepreneurs struggle to carry out marketing plans for mobile applications.
User needs are addressed differently by each mobile application, and analyzing both the industry and user base is critical in developing marketing techniques for promotion purposes.
One effective promotion application development methodologies is running online campaigns; testing will help make sure all nooks and crannies of the application have been smoothed over and make your app a powerful business goals asset that connects directly to its target users.
Additional Key Factors For Mobile App Development
Scalability
Scalability should always be prioritized over other considerations when developing software applications, even when one knows how much this might cost.Scalable apps allow software development companies to manage a rise in users without negatively affecting user experience - something users depend on immensely.
As part of your scalability planning, it is necessary to consider mistakes, failures, outages and the possibility of crashes and downtime.Enhancing user experience increases brand loyalty.
Security And Privacy Policies Of Companies
Security for user data collected online is of utmost importance, so any app collecting sensitive user information must include robust safeguards that safeguard such sensitive information.
When your software features transactional capabilities, user security must take priority. All privacy policies should be communicated to users within an app to assure them that their data remains protected and wont ever be misused by unauthorized parties.
A Polished Feel
Apps that exhibit subpar designs show just how much effort was expended into developing them, with deficient designs being the product of hours upon hours of work put in by its developers.
What defines an apps success, then? An elegant aesthetic would likely come to mind. An outstanding app will pay special attention to even its most minor details to stand out; consumers favor appealing apps that address their problems immediately and if an unappealing one does exist theyre quick to delete it immediately.
Robust USP
High-quality apps always boast an alluring USP (Unique Selling Point). UrbanClaps success can be traced to its innovative USP of providing home services such as repairs and cosmetic salon services through its app - something no other business model did at that time.
Focus On One Core Feature
One of the greatest assets of your app should be well-known among its target users. Do not focus on marketing multiple features simultaneously; users will not adopt apps with too many functions simultaneously.
A successful app must focus on one goal and accomplish it very efficiently; to focus your energy effectively, identify what motivated its creation first, as this motivation could also fuel its central feature development.
Application Resolves Issues
Because mobile applications provide digital solutions to an issue, they are sometimes known as digital solutions.
With so many cross-platform apps out there that may solve that same issue for success factors like parking solutions at malls without car locator features available, yet another would add further depth of use and usability of that app. As one success factor example, adding car locator capabilities would increase user adoption.
Conclusion
Over 2 billion individuals currently use cell phones.More mobile devices than PCs are circulating today, and roughly 70% of users spend time browsing apps.
In comparison, 80% utilize these same applications to book, pay for and make purchases - regardless of industry sector. Mobile applications offer businesses tremendous growth potential that should be addressed when developing apps to expand their business reach - make sure these factors are considered before designing an app for your organization.
Developers.dev is an award-winning mobile application development business. After several research project requirements focused on security, data management, resource optimization and user experience, Developers.dev developed its unique understanding of mobile app development methodologies.
We deliver mobile apps to our partners that bring high efficiency to their business requirements while increasing brand recognition of their offerings - we specialize in hybrid mobile apps and native Android or iOS applications; lets collaborate and change how you work.
Smartphone ownership will likely skyrocket over the coming years, making mobile applications ideal for companies to reach potential customers online and stay relevant in todays ever-evolving business climate.
Utilizing apps can help your company take up an increasing share of market space while keeping regular communication open between yourself and consumers and keeping them abreast of changes within your firm. Take your time; get one created today for your firm; creating one is more of a strategic than a technical decision; it should reflect both the goals and values set by your firm.